王相晶,女,1972年生,博士,教授,博士生導師東北農業大學生命學院教授

王相晶教育進修

博士後,浙江大學,2003-2005
博士,哈爾濱工業大學,2000-2003
碩士,東北農業大學,1997-2000
學士,東北農業大學,1989-1992

王相晶工作經歷

2003年10月評為副教授;2005年12月聘為責任教授,2007年9月評為教授,2008年7月評為博士生導師。

王相晶主講課程

主講本科生課程《工業微生物》、《生物學專業外語》,主講碩士研究生課程《微生物育種》課程。

王相晶研究方向

Current research interests are about isolating and screening of antibiotic-generating strain, secondary metabolite biosynthesis in microorganisms, gene cloning and expression, enzyme reaction mechanisms, metabolic pathway engineering, and natural product drug discovery and development.

王相晶研究課題

1、冰城鏈黴菌生物合成米爾貝黴素基因簇基因克隆及功能分析,國家自然基金,2010-2012,主持人
2、米爾貝黴素原料藥的研製與應用,“十一五”國家支撐重點子項目,2007~2010 主持人
3、刪除影響米爾貝黴素生物工藝雜質的高產菌株的選育,黑龍江省教育廳基金,2007~2009 主持人
4、冰城鏈黴菌生物合成米爾貝黴素基因克隆與功能分析,國家博士後基金一等,2007~2008 主持人
5、生物農藥米爾貝黴素高產菌株的選育和發酵工藝的優化,黑龍江省青年專項基金,主持人
6、生物農藥多殺菌素生產菌的選育和發酵工藝優化研究,哈爾濱市青年專項基金,主持人
7、γ-氨基丁酸受體篩選模型建立及作用,黑龍江省博士後啓動基金,2005~2008 主持人
8、高濃度抗生素廢水生物處理新技術與應用研究,國家博士後基金二等,2003~2005 主持人
9、高濃度製藥廢水生物處理新技術與應用研究,浙江省博士後基金, 2003~2005 主持人
10、高濃度製藥廢水厭氧生物處理技術研究,校博士啓動基金,2005~2008 主持人
